Adrien Broner still believes he has all the skills to become the undisputed champion again.

Broner hasn’t won a fight at 140lbs in nearly eight years and is fighting at 147lbs on June 9 in Miami against Bill Hutchinson. Although Broner will be a massive favorite, he says Hutchinson is dangerous but he is confident he will win and then pursue the 140lbs titles.

“I know this guy that I’m supposed to fight, he ain’t lost in seven years,” Broner said of Hutchinson (h/t BoxingScene). “And I’m proud to hear that. But, you know, come June 9th, you know, we got some sh!t in store. And we ain’t looking at him like a stepping stone. But, you know, I set some goals to myself that I can’t let myself down. And what I wanna do is I wanna become world champion again under the Don King, you know, stable. So, for me, first I gotta get through Hutchinson. And that’s what I’m gonna do for sure. And then we’re gonna pursue the 140 world titles. And I wanna become the undisputed [champion] at 140 pounds. So, you know, I got big plans and I been working my ass off. And June 9th, I’m gonna put on a show.”

Although Broner believes he can become the champ at 140lbs, he hasn’t fought at that weight since he suffered a loss to Mikey Garcia in 2017. However, he has won world titles in four weight classes so he is confident he can have a lot of success at 140lbs.

Adrien Broner (34-4-1) hasn’t fought since February of 2021 when he beat Jovanie Santiago by decision. Prior to that, he suffered a decision loss to Manny Pacquiao and had a draw against Jessie Vargas and a decision setback against Garcia. In his career, he also holds notable wins over Paulie Malignaggi, Gavin Rees, and Eloy Perez among others.
